您好,登錄后才能下訂單哦!
今天小編給大家分享的是零基礎學習編程應該先學什么,很多人都不太了解,今天小編為了讓大家更加了解零基礎學習編程的方法,所以給大家總結了以下內容,一起往下看吧。一定會有所收獲的哦。
一、零基礎編程入門找一門感興趣的編程語言
要想成為程序員,先學習一門編程語言掌握編程思維、找到編程感覺。很多編程語言是有相同之處的。學會C++,JAVA也能很快上手。學好一門語言,在學習新的編程語言時,了解該語言的語法特點,入門更容易。一名程序員豐富的實操經驗都是在反復的實踐、觀察、分析、比較中慢慢積累的,不是一篇文章或者兩三小時學會的。
學會編程思維找到編程感覺,需要在編程實際工作中去實踐和街壘。不少人在學習編程時只懂簡單的語法、結構,學習過程枯燥目的性也不強,大大降低初學者的興趣和學習效果。一般的書籍,從語言本身去講解語法和舉一些針對這些語法的應用例子,跟使用說明書沒有太大差別,僅僅灌輸編程思想,培養編程感覺的作用。
許多大學生在學校學過C語言,但真正精通C語言的編程者極少,大部分人只是簡單了解些語法,許多重要的知識點含糊不清。對于英語,現階段了解相關的代碼語言就可以。
二、在學習過程中不斷練習實踐
學習語言的過程中進行檢驗,不能只編寫代碼,還要檢驗代碼的結果運行是否正確,某些可以運行結果的軟件,不過許多的編程語言都要求有被程序員設計來講代碼轉換成機器能理解的語言的編譯器。其他一些語言,比如Python,使用可以立即轉換成程序而不需要編譯。一些語言有自己的往往包含著代碼編輯器、調試器和/或者翻譯以及調試的IDEs。程序員在同一個地方去執行任何必要的功能。IDEs可能還包含著包含對象層次結構和目錄的可視化界面。
要學會習慣編程序的過程中不斷修復錯誤和漏洞,在編程時碰到bug,存在程序中并且可能隨時隨地的出現在程序中的任何一個地方。漏洞可能會破壞程序,或者只是讓程序不能編譯/運行。捕捉和修復這些錯誤在軟件開發周期中這是一個主要的過程,要早早地習慣于這么做。
三、編程算術運算方法
學習數學和邏輯,大多編程涉及基本的算術運算,但可能你想要學習更先進的概念。如果你想寫出復雜的模擬或者算法級別程序,這很重要的。對于大多數日常編程而言不需要太多先進的數學知識。但學習邏輯,尤其是計算機邏輯,將能幫助你理解處理更先進程序的復雜問題的最好方式。
只看很難學會。需要搭建環境來多練習才能完全掌握語法。編程學習沒有捷徑可走,只有入門快慢之分。編程入門后學什么語言不太重要主要看職業規劃的發展方向。程序設計的核心在于其邏輯,把程序設計的邏輯搞懂學什么語言都很快。
以上就是零基礎學習編程應該先學什么的簡略介紹,當然詳細使用上面的不同還得要大家自己使用過才領會。如果想了解更多,歡迎關注億速云行業資訊頻道哦!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。